OOM-ORL-ROOF Composite Flap Suspension (ORRCS) to the Lateral Orbital Thickening for Lateral Hooding.

Ying Lv … Pu Chun
Aesthetic plastic surgery · 2026
Background

Lateral hooding of the upper eyelid is a common yet frequently undertreated aspect of periorbital aging in East Asians.

Purpose

This study aimed to investigate the roles of the orbicularis oculi muscle (orbicularis oculi muscle), retro-orbicularis oculi fat (retro-orbicularis oculi fat), orbicularis retaining ligament (orbicularis retaining ligament), and lateral orbital thickening (lateral orbital thickening) in the pathogenesis and to evaluate the novel orbicularis oculi muscle-orbicularis retaining ligament-retro-orbicularis oculi fat composite suspension (ORRCS) technique.

Methods

Clinical outcomes of the ORRCS procedure were retrospectively reviewed in 85 East Asian patients with lateral dermatochalasis (LDC grade ≥1).

n = 85 East Asian patients
Results

eyelid drooping severity dropped sharply after surgery, showing marked improvement

Preoperative
2.24LDC gr
Postoperative
0.4LDC gr
More results

Brow position remained stable ( p >0.05).

Scars were inconspicuous, with no major complications and high patient satisfaction (4.7/5).

“
Conclusion · 1 of 3

Lateral hooding primarily results from the descent of the OOM-ORL-ROOF composite unit due to the attenuation of the deep ORL-lateral orbital thickening retaining complex.

Conclusion · 2 of 3

The ORRCS technique corrects this deformity by re-suspending the complex to the robust lateral orbital thickening, providing a promising anatomy-guided deep-plane approach with favorable early outcomes in this cohort while restoring a natural contour and preserving brow dynamics.

Conclusion · 3 of 3
